I'm sure most of you have now met Rhiannon our newest member of the shop team. Rhi's love of golf is infectious and she travels literally all over the country to play and watch. Recently she went to Woburn to watch the Ladies British Open. Below is brief description of her experience.
'I recently visited Woburn for the first day of the Ladies British Open Championship. After watching a few players down the first hole it is nice to know that even top level professionals don't get it out of the bunker on their first go! There were a few things that I noticed which separate top professional golfers from club golfers. From 100 yards in they were 90% of the time leaving themselves a makeable birdie putt, and if they were over 30ft from the hole with their first putt they would get it within 3ft of the hole 90% of the time. Eliminating 3 putts can really help the score drop down! I managed to see Laura Davies tee off the 18th, setting up with just an iron in her hand she split the fairway in half, it's nice to see that she has still got it!'

More international honours for the boys
Once again Owen and Jack have been out competing but this time a little closer to home.
Last week the boys pegged up in the qualifying round of the Welsh Amateur Championship at Southerndown. Both qualified for the match play stages, Owen finishing in 7th place and Jack in 21st. Jack won his first match 3&1 but unfortunately lost to Llewellyn Matthews in the second round. Owen won both his matches on extra holes and went on to win his quarter finals and semi finals match. In the final he was 4 down after 18 holes, but fought back well in the second round narrowly missing out on the title on the 18th.
A huge 'Well Done" to both boys who have been selected to represent Wales at the Home Internationals at Nairn Golf Club on the 9th-12th August.
